Optimizing Business Central Performance - A Consultants Guide

Performance issues in Business Central rarely announce themselves in advance. They build quietly, through configuration choices, database growth, user load patterns and infrastructure decisions made early in a project, until one day a client calls to say the system is slow.

In this expert session, Microsoft MVP and MCT Berny Düring gives consultants the knowledge to get ahead of that call rather than respond to it.
Berny covers the full performance landscape, from system and application settings through hardware and infrastructure considerations, database management, user load optimization and advanced troubleshooting.

Real-world examples and practical best practices run throughout, giving you the kind of rounded, field-tested insight that turns performance optimization from a reactive scramble into a proactive discipline.

Webinar Content
1. Introduction to Performance Optimization in Business Central
  • Overview of the critical components affecting performance.
  • Importance of performance tuning for consultants and businesses.
2. Understanding System and Application Settings
  • Key configurations in Business Central that impact performance.
  • Practical steps to optimize these settings for different business scenarios.
3. Hardware and Infrastructure Considerations
  • Recommended hardware configurations for optimal performance.
  • Impact of network latency and bandwidth on Business Central environments.
  • Best practices for infrastructure setup and scaling.
4. Database Management and Growth Control
  • How database growth affects system performance.
  • Techniques for managing data retention and cleanup.
  • Tools and methods for monitoring and managing database performance.
5. User Load Optimization and Monitoring
  • Strategies for managing user sessions and load balancing.
  • Identifying and addressing high-load scenarios.
  • Leveraging telemetry and performance analytics for ongoing monitoring.
6. Advanced Troubleshooting and Future-Proofing
  • Advanced diagnostic techniques for complex performance issues.
  • Planning for future growth and scalability to maintain performance.
  • Leveraging community and expert insights for continuous improvement.
7. Q&A and Closing Remarks
  • Open floor for participant questions and discussions.
  • Recap of key takeaways and next steps for further learning.

Who is this course for?

Consultants, system administrators, developers and Business Central professionals involved in system maintenance and optimization who want to build a proactive, structured approach to Business Central performance. A basic understanding of Business Central features and functionality is recommended.

What will you learn?

  • Which key settings and configurations in Business Central have the greatest impact on system performance
  • How hardware configurations and database management practices affect overall performance in practice
  • How to diagnose and address the most common performance bottlenecks in Business Central environments
  • How to implement best practices for user load optimization to prevent backend overload before it becomes a problem
  • How to recognize signs of database growth issues and apply strategies to manage and mitigate them
  • How to future-proof your Business Central environments and proactively optimize before performance issues arise
